Jack Tatum is the Virginia native who has gone from relative unknown to the forefront of the indie rock scene in a matter of months. When recording, he goes by the name of Wild Nothing, and after several leaks and singles, his debut album Gemini finally hit stores earlier this month. His sound is clearly driven by a fascination with nostalgia, but manages to remain one of the freshest-sounding records out. He's in NYC tonight to tear it down for a sold-out crowd at the Music Hall of Williamsburg; if you haven't been paying attention to this guy, it's time to start.
